Here's the response from Canon:
Thank you for contacting Canon product support. We value you as a
Canon customer and appreciate the opportunity to assist you. I am
sorry that your PIXMA MP560 is not recognizing the CLI-221 and PGI-220
ink tanks you purchased.
The reason that the printer is not recognizing these ink tanks is
because these were purchased here in the United States and your PIXMA
MP560 was from the United Kingdom. The ink must be purchased from the
Canon division where you purchased the printer. Unfortunately, this
means that the ink from the United States would not work in your UK
PIXMA MP560. It would need to come from a United Kingdom dealer.
I am sorry for any inconvenience this causes. Please let us know if
we can be of further assistance with your PIXMA MP560.
TLDR Canon region locks its print cartridges.
Update: It is possible to alter the region of cartridges, notably using a "redsetter" device, which also resets ink levels (as electronically recorded).
